I have an older Mac (specs attached). I upgraded the memory and the hard drive to SSD. I still see considerable lag in performance often and especially when I try to use Citrix Workspace for work.

Any recommendations on how to get better performance?
I installed Onyx and will be running its tests shortly.

It's an 11-year old iMac with a Core 2 Duo. Installing RAM and replacing the hard drive with an SSD does not change the fact that you CPU and GPU are dead slow compared to their modern equivalents. It doesn't surprise me that you are seeing considerable lag, and quite frankly I don't think there's much you can do about it.
